📜  SQL Server 中的 UPPER()函数

📅  最后修改于: 2022-05-13 01:54:51.460000             🧑  作者: Mango

SQL Server 中的 UPPER()函数

上():
SQL Server 中的此函数有助于将给定字符串的所有字母转换为大写。如果给定的字符串包含特殊字符或数值,那么它们将通过此函数保持不变。

句法 :

UPPER( str )

参数 :

  • str -将被转换为大写的字符串

结果 :
此函数将返回大写字符串。

示例-1:
将 UPPER()函数与小写字符串一起使用。

SELECT UPPER('be patience be awake') 
As New;

输出 :

New

BE PATIENCE BE AWAKE

示例 2 :
将 UPPER()函数与混合大小写字符串一起使用。

SELECT UPPER('EvERy DAy iS A NEW day') 
As New;

输出 :

New

EVERY DAY IS A NEW DAY

示例 3 :
在 Select 语句中使用 UPPER()函数。
创建 Players 表并在其中插入值。

Create table Players
(
 Firstname varchar(40),
 Lastname varchar(40),
 Country varchar(40)
)

向玩家插入数据:

Insert into Players values 
('Kane', 'Williamson', 'New Zealand')

桌子看起来像。

FirstnameLastnameCountry
KaneWilliamsonNew Zealand

UPPER()函数的使用。

SELECT Firstname,  
      UPPER(Lastname) As New_name,  
      Country
FROM Players;

输出 :

FirstnameNew_nameCountry
KaneWILLIAMSONNew Zealand

示例 4:
在变量中使用 UPPER()函数。

DECLARE @text VARCHAR(45);
SET @text = 'be happy be light ';
SELECT @text,  
      UPPER(@text) AS Upper;

输出 :

Text valueUpper
be happy be lightBE HAPPY BE LIGHT